All quiet in the Windy City
Chris Kuc of the Chicago Tribune reports that Chicago Blackhawks GM Dale Tallon is not actively looking to make any trade or shopping for free agents.
When asked about the likes of defensemen Pavel Kubina and Danny Markov, and forward Tony Amonte being named in Internet rumors as possibly headed to Chicago, Tallon’s response was succinct.
“Nope.”
Tallon went on to say that he hasn’t had any recent conversations with other GMs or player agents in regards to trades or free agents signings.
However, while Tallon appears to be comfortable with the team he has assembled thus far, he remains interested in improving his club should a deal that betters his roster comes along.
“We’re going to see how training camp goes and see what we have,” Tallon said. “We never stop listening to any deal if it makes sense to improve our team. But it’s kind of quiet right now.”
